The Science Behind 3M Color Selection
3M vinyl films are engineered with multi-layered cast construction to ensure stability during the intense heat of a professional heat gun application. When you pick a color from their chart, you aren’t just choosing a shade; you’re selecting specific chemical properties like conformability and adhesive tack. These films must stretch over complex curves, like side mirrors or bumpers, without losing pigment density or popping back into their original shape.

Why Professional Installers Prefer 3M Material
Reliability remains the main driver for professionals selecting 3M over cheaper alternatives. Because 3M utilizes Controltac and Comply adhesive technologies, the film features microscopic air-release channels. These channels allow trapped air to escape during the squeegee process, which reduces the chance of bubbles forming after the car leaves the garage. This technical advantage saves labor hours and produces a cleaner finish that lasts between five to seven years if maintained properly.
Selecting the Right Finish for Your Needs
Choose between gloss, satin, matte, color-flip, and carbon fiber textures depending on your vehicle’s body lines. Matte colors tend to hide minor imperfections or orange peel in the bodywork, whereas high-gloss films act like a mirror, reflecting every tiny ripple in the underlying surface. If you drive a vintage vehicle with uneven body filler, avoid the high-gloss options unless you want those areas to stand out like a sore thumb.
Comparing Color Consistency Across Batches
Unexpectedly, the chemical makeup of deep reds and dark blues can vary slightly between production runs. I once had to finish a hood with a roll from a different manufacturing batch, and the shift in pigment saturation was immediately apparent under fluorescent shop lights. Always ensure that your installer pulls all the material required for your specific vehicle from the same production lot to guarantee an identical color match across all body panels.
Common Pitfalls in Color Mapping
Many owners obsess over screen-based digital charts, but looking at a digital pixel map is a recipe for disappointment. Screens use RGB light, while vinyl uses physical pigment that interacts with light in the real world. You must visit a shop and hold an actual swatch book up to your car in both direct sunlight and shade. What looks like a deep, sophisticated midnight blue on your monitor might turn into a flat, dusty navy when sitting in your driveway at dawn.
Managing Expectations for Longevity
Horizontal surfaces like your roof and hood face the most intense UV degradation because they catch the sun’s rays at the most direct angle. A bright yellow or neon color will naturally fade faster than a metallic gray, regardless of the brand quality. When choosing from the 3M color chart, ask your installer for the specific durability rating of that color. Darker, metallic-heavy colors usually retain their depth longer than solid, pastel-based colors.

Evaluating Maintenance Requirements
Darker, matte finishes are notoriously difficult to clean because they absorb oils from fingerprints and road grime. You cannot simply wax a matte wrap as you would standard paint, because the wax fills the tiny texture of the film, creating patchy shiny spots. If you want a low-maintenance look, stick to the 3M satin or gloss lines, which can be wiped down with specialized wrap cleaners or simple water and mild soap.
The Economic Reality of Custom Colors
Custom colors or limited edition shades often come with a higher price tag due to supply chain scarcity. When a specific color is discontinued, finding enough material to repair a damaged panel later becomes a logistical nightmare. Some of the most unique “Color Flip” options in the 3M catalog have short shelf lives before being replaced by newer trends, so check the stock availability before falling in love with a discontinued shade.
